Factors Affecting Cost
- Pipe Material: Different materials like copper, PVC, and PEX have varying costs.
- Length of Pipe: The longer the pipe that needs replacing, the higher the cost.
- Labor Rates: Labor costs can vary based on the expertise and rates of local plumbers in Rockville.
-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as may require more labor and specialized equipment.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the cost.
- Complexity of the Job: More complex jobs that involve multiple fixtures or rerouting may cost more.
- Emergency Services: Urgent replacements typically incur higher costs.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Rockville, MD) |
---|---|
Replacing a section of pipe | $200 - $600 |
Whole-house pipe replacement | $4,000 - $15,000 |
Replacing main water line | $1,500 - $4,000 |
Replacing sewer line | $3,000 - $7,000 |
Installing new plumbing fixtures | $150 - $500 per fixture |
Leak detection and repair | $150 - $400 |
